An information session is going to be given this coming 1 March, on adaptation for compliance with the Act on the Common Administrative Procedure of Public Authorities (LPACAP) in contracts from IMI’s Department of Development.

IMI's functions are the development, maintenance and evolution of efficient and productive ICT solutions for city residents and municipal employees. Our goal is to supply all the information and communication technology (ICT) services to Barcelona City Council and its subsidiary public sector companies.

The new Act 39/2015, of 1 October, on the Common Administrative Procedure of Public Authorities (LPACAP) establishes that e-procedures have to constitute the regular actions of the Public Authorities to better serve the principles of effectiveness and efficiency in cost saving, transparency obligations and citizens’ guarantees. The City Council already has e-signature, document management, notification, inter-operability and payment systems available and these need to be adapted to the new requirements set out in the LPACAP. That is why the Department of Development will be presenting:

  • Adaptation of the e-signature systems: this will keep the applications free of the technological problems associated with e-document signing, by doing away with the need for each of them to establish the various logics that arise from this action.
  • Document management adaptation: Adaptation of the settings for the Open Text platform and the document management modules, for compliance with the requirements that come from Act 39/2015.
  • E-notification adaptation: E-government services that enable e-notifications to be sent and users to subscribe to them.
  • Payment gateway updating: E-government services that enable online payments of the City Council's taxes and public sector charges.
  • Inter-operability platform adaptation: Published Service Layer that provides or uses services from other authorities through the AOC's inter-operability node. This service layer enables the City Council’s applications to be used for consulting data from, for example, the Directorate-General for Traffic (DGT), the Spanish Tax Agency (AEAT) and any other authority that offers services.
  • Empowerment management adaptation: Service Module that enables permits and powers before Barcelona City Council to be delegated from a natural or legal person to a third-party natural or legal person.
